A brief overview of ProHealth Physicians: Connecticut’s leading community‑based medical group, founded in 1997, with 300+ doctors and advanced practice clinicians. We serve children and adults of all ages and offer in‑house imaging and clinical lab services. We focus on prevention and providing patients with the tools they need to stay well.
